Abstract
: AI-based dermatology systems achieve high diagnostic accuracy but demonstrate reduced performance in darker skin tones and non-specialist environments. These findings emphasize the need for diverse training datasets, skin-tone-stratified reporting, and rigorous external validation before broad clinical deployment.
